Today, we are thrilled to announce that the Construction Industry Workforce Initiative (CIWI), a pioneering partnership dedicated to transforming and diversifying the construction workforce in the Bay Area, has successfully raised $1 million in funding. This significant investment reflects the growing recognition of the vital role that a diverse and skilled workforce plays in the construction and real estate industries. CIWI, a program of Community Initiatives, aims to bridge the gap in opportunities within multiple sectors, including Construction, Real Estate Development, Architecture and Engineering, Civic Engagement, and Urban Design. With this new funding, CIWI plans to launch a series of comprehensive training programs that will provide underrepresented communities with the skills and resources necessary to thrive in these fields. Additionally, the funds will support initiatives that foster strong partnerships between private sector companies and educational institutions, ensuring a robust pipeline of talent that is reflective of the diverse Bay Area community. The investment also aims to enhance outreach efforts to engage minorities, women, and individuals from disadvantaged backgrounds who are often excluded from these lucrative industry opportunities.
